The Bently Nevada 330194-00-07-10-05, also cataloged as the 330194-00-07-10-05 Proximity Probes, operates as a dedicated hardware component for eddy-current probe scaling and rotor dynamics monitoring within industrial rotating machinery protection networks.

Suffix Breakdown And Model Matrix

  • 330194: Base model designation for the 3300 XL 8 mm Extended Temperature Range probe with M10 x 1 thread and armor.
  • 00: Unthreaded length option of 0 mm.
  • 07: Minimum case length option of 70 mm.
  • 10: Total cable length option of 1.0 meter.
  • 05: Agency approval option including CSA, ATEX, and IECEx certifications.

Rotor Dynamics And Gap Voltage Validation

  • Gap Voltage Target: Configured to output a direct voltage proportional to distance, targeting -10 VDC to -12 VDC during cold static positioning.
  • Eddy-Current Scaling: Translates magnetic field fluctuations into precise displacement signals for radial vibration and axial position monitoring.
  • Cross-Talk Suppression: Employs coaxial shielding and matched electrical matching networks to isolate high-frequency interference on extended cable runs.
  • Frequency Response: Delivers linear output performance from 0 Hz (static position) up to 10 kHz (dynamic vibration) across fluid-film bearing setups.

Mechanical Mounting And Cabling Guidelines

  • Thread Engagement: Install the M10 x 1 threaded body into the machine housing while ensuring maximum thread engagement does not exceed 15 mm to prevent mechanical binding.
  • Torque Specifications: Apply calibrated torque wrenches to avoid over-tightening the probe case against the mounting aperture.
  • Cable Routing: Keep coaxial signal leads clear of high-voltage motor power cables to minimize electromagnetic coupling into the monitoring channel.
  • Grounding Standards: Terminate probe shield drains exclusively at the Proximitor sensor ground stud to avoid ground loops.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• Question: What is the primary function of the 330194-00-07-10-05 probe?

    Answer: It converts physical distance between the probe tip and a conductive target into an electrical voltage signal for vibration analysis.

  • Question: Does this sensor require external electrical power?

    Answer: No, it operates passively, receiving excitation current from a compatible 3300 XL Proximitor Sensor.

  • Question: What thread size does the probe housing feature?

    Answer: The unit is machined with an M10 x 1 thread pattern for direct machinery port insertion.

  • Question: What is the maximum allowable thread engagement?

    Answer: Thread engagement must be kept under 15 mm to avoid structural binding or thread stripping during installation.

  • Question: Can this ETR probe be paired with standard extension cables?

    Answer: Yes, extended temperature range components are fully compatible with standard 3300 XL extension cables.

  • Question: What is the standard static gap voltage setting?

    Answer: The gap is typically adjusted to yield between -10 VDC and -12 VDC during initial cold alignment.
